How to Make Slow Cooked Ravioli

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Step 1: Prepare Your Slow Cooker

Start by spraying your slow cooker with nonstick spray or lightly coating it with olive oil. This prevents sticking and ensures easy cleanup later on.

Step 2: Layer Ingredients

Pour half of the marinara sauce into the bottom of the slow cooker. Then layer half of the frozen ravioli over the sauce without overlapping them too much.

Step 3: Add More Sauce and Basil

Spread a layer of fresh basil over the ravioli followed by another generous helping of marinara sauce. Repeat with another layer of ravioli and finish with remaining sauce.

Step 4: Cook Low and Slow

Cover your slow cooker and cook on low for about four hours or on high for two hours. The ravioli should be tender but still hold their shape.

Step 5: Add Cheese

In the last few minutes of cooking, sprinkle grated Parmesan cheese over the top so it melts beautifully into all those layers.

Step 6: Serve It Up

Once done cooking, give everything a gentle stir before serving. Transfer to plates and drizzle with extra marinara sauce if desired for that perfect finishing touch.

Storing & Reheating

To store, place leftover slow cooked ravioli in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to three days. When reheating, do so gently on the stovetop with a splash of broth to keep it moist.

Can I use frozen ravioli for Slow Cooked Ravioli?

Yes, you can definitely use frozen ravioli for slow cooked ravioli! Frozen ravioli save time and still deliver great taste. Simply layer them in the slow cooker with sauce and cook on low heat. It’s important to add extra sauce to ensure that the ravioli cooks properly without drying out. This makes it an ideal option for quick dinners that don’t compromise on flavor.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 24 oz frozen ravioli (cheese, meat, or vegetable)
  • 4 cups marinara sauce (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 cup fresh basil leaves
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tbsp olive oil

Instructions

  1. Spray the slow cooker with nonstick spray.
  2. Layer half of the marinara sauce at the bottom, followed by half of the frozen ravioli.
  3. Add a layer of fresh basil and more marinara sauce. Repeat with remaining ravioli and sauce.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 4 hours or high for 2 hours until ravioli are tender.
  5. In the last few minutes of cooking, sprinkle grated Parmesan on top to melt.
  6. Stir gently before serving and enjoy!
